The discovery, Lukin said, runs contrary to decades of accepted wisdom about the nature of light. Photons have long been described as massless particles which don’t interact with each other — shine two laser beams at each other, he said, and they simply pass through one another.

“Photonic molecules,” however, behave less like traditional lasers and more like something you might find in science fiction — the light saber.

-Harvard University. “Seeing light in a new light: Scientists create never-before-seen form of matter.” ScienceDaily, 25 Sep. 2013. Web. 26 Sep. 2013.
